Josh Hazlewood Faces Fresh Injury Blow

Australian pace spearhead Josh Hazlewood is set to miss the remainder of the Test series against India after suffering a calf strain during warm-ups on Day 4 of the Brisbane Test. This injury comes as a big setback for Hazlewood, who had just returned to the side following a previous side strain.

Hazlewood managed to bowl only one over on the fourth day before walking off the field due to discomfort. The news was confirmed after scans revealed the severity of his calf injury.


What Happened to Hazlewood?

Assistant coach Daniel Vettori said, “He’s pretty despondent. He put in so much effort after recovering from his side strain, so to get injured again is really tough for him.”


Who Could Replace Hazlewood?

With Hazlewood out, Australia will need a reliable replacement. Here are the top contenders:

  1. Scott Boland
    • Boland is the frontrunner to step in.
    • The Boxing Day Test at the MCG is his ideal hunting ground, where he famously took 6 for 7 against England on debut in 2021.
    • Captain Cummins had earlier hinted at Boland’s potential return, saying, “Prepare for the MCG; there’s always natural attrition in a Test series.”
  2. Brendan Doggett or Sean Abbott
    • Both bowlers were included in the squad earlier as cover for Hazlewood.
    • Either could be called up again depending on fitness and conditions.
  3. Lance Morris or Jhye Richardson
    • Both are still working their way back to red-ball cricket after injuries.
    • With the domestic focus shifting to the BBL, they may not be match-ready for Test duties.
